O R D E R

% 17.09.2019 1.

Learned APP for the State submitted that the Trial Court has already passed the order of discharge vide order dated 28.8.2019. 2.

Learned counsel for the petitioner submitted that he is not aware about the same and he may be allowed to withdraw the present petition with the liberty to raise all the contentions including challenging of the order dated 28.8.2019 before the competent Court in the appropriate proceedings, as per law. Accordingly, the petition is dismissed as withdrawn with the liberty as prayed for. Pending application is also dismissed as withdrawn.
